Output 836383a20cc447918ec0f8600d402938e95fa9b8de311da3df824094c9a64edd:5

value
242920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f0b2543d0669b306db475f6c5a3bfc64455ade OP_EQUAL
address
34nUZmSLEoMaCNh1sWv63Ha1Ao3Y7xURoF
transaction
836383a20cc447918ec0f8600d402938e95fa9b8de311da3df824094c9a64edd
spent
true